計算機二級考試VB和C語言哪個更簡單點

時間 2021-08-14 09:05:51

1樓:山東中公優就業

vb簡單。

visual basic是一種由 microsoft 公司開發的結構化的、模組化的、物件導向的、包含協助開發環境的事件驅動為機制的視覺化程式設計語言。從任何標準來說,vb都是世界上使用人數最多的語言——不管是盛讚vb的開發者還是抱怨vb的開發者的數量。它源自於basic程式語言。

vb擁有圖形使用者介面(gui)和快速應用程式開發(rad)系統,可以輕易的使用dao、rdo、ado連線資料庫,或者輕鬆的建立activex控制元件。程式設計師可以輕鬆的使用vb提供的元件快速建立一個應用程式。

c語言是一門通用計算機程式語言,應用廣泛。c語言的設計目標是提供一種能以簡易的方式編譯、處理低階儲存器、產生少量的機器碼以及不需要任何執行環境支援便能執行的程式語言。

儘管c語言提供了許多低階處理的功能,但仍然保持著良好跨平臺的特性,以一個標準規格寫出的c語言程式可在許多電腦平臺上進行編譯,甚至包含一些嵌入式處理器(微控制器或稱mcu)以及超級電腦等作業平臺。

二十世紀八十年代,為了避免各開發廠商用的c語言語法產生差異,由美國國家標準局為c語言訂定了一套完整的國際標準語法,稱為ansi c,作為c語言最初的標準。

2樓:癯月笑浮生

都差不多,我感覺c更簡單一點,我報的c++

計算機二級考試vb和c語言哪個更好

3樓:閃閃s閃

vb,函式和結構比較簡單(相對而言),對於系統底層的支援比較困難,也就是說,必須依回託一定的作業系統,才答能順利的執行。適合對編成感興趣,自學和製作簡單程式的人員,通過vb能進一步鍛鍊邏輯思維能力和對全域性的掌握。

c,是一種集低階語言和高階語言一體的語言,既能完全脫開作業系統,直接對硬體進行操作,僅高於組合語言,又能製作出直接面向與使用者的介面程式,適合編寫大型的程式,系統等等。所以複雜性也是不言而喻的了。它要求很強的邏輯思維能力。

適合專業的程式設計師,也是程式設計師的必須掌握的語言。

對於不找程式設計類工作的學生,c語言的實用性不是很高。

若是有一定的vb基礎,建議還是考vb吧。

4樓:道以萬記

據說vb簡單些。

vb主要應用於對micro office的操作c相對應用比較廣,但也難學精(比如指標,記憶體等),專業程式語言計算機二級並不高,考出來不過有點基礎,說到應用程式設計,差的遠哩。

5樓:匿名使用者

現在學的抄多的是c++吧,感覺

襲c++比vb更高階.所以肯定baic更流行.但是從學習到du自己編寫使用程式還是有不少zhi差距的.

所以如dao果自己沒有特別要求的話就考個vb吧,對程式語言有個瞭解足夠了.而且一般單位也不會深究你到底考的什麼語言.有證就行!

6樓:冰是沉默的水

vb是基本建立在c語言基礎之上的,學了c之後學vb簡單的多,而且個人覺得c語言入門容易回

點,沒有那麼多的東答西需要記,

說起比較哪個好都是看在什麼方面的使用,都學學更好!如果一個vb寫個介面只需要拉幾個控制元件就好,但c語言就可能要用十幾行**。。。

其他的還有delphi之類的,也可以看看,但都基本差不多-物聯網校企聯盟技術部

計算機二級考試c語言與c++有什麼區別

7樓:孤影別秀了

兩者區別如下:

一、程式語言型別不同

c語言是一門程序導向、抽象化的通用程式設計語言,廣泛應用於底層開發。c語言能以簡易的方式編譯、處理低階儲存器。c語言是僅產生少量的機器語言以及不需要任何執行環境支援便能執行的高效率程式設計語言。

既可用來編寫系統軟體,又可用來開發應用軟體。

c++是c語言的繼承,它既可以進行c語言的過程化程式設計,又可以進行以抽象資料型別為特點的基於物件的程式設計,還可以進行以繼承和多型為特點的物件導向的程式設計。c++擅長物件導向程式設計的同時,還可以進行基於過程的程式設計。

二、程式語言特性不同

c語言描述問題比組合語言迅速,工作量小、可讀性好,易於除錯、修改和移植,而**質量與組合語言相當。c語言一般只比組合語言**生成的目標程式效率低10%~20%。因此,c語言編譯器普遍存在於各種不同的作業系統中,c語言可以編寫系統軟體。

c++語言的程式因為要體現高效能,所以都是編譯型的。但其開發環境,為了方便測試,將除錯環境做成解釋型的。即開發過程中,以解釋型的逐條語句執行方式來進行除錯,以編譯型的脫離開發環境而啟動執行的方式來生成程式最終的執行**。

擴充套件資料

c語言的優勢特性:

1、c語言是一個有結構化程式設計、具有變數作用域(variable scope)以及遞迴功能的過程式語言。

2、c語言傳遞引數均是以值傳遞(pass by value),另外也可以傳遞指標(a pointer passed by value)。

3、不同的變數型別可以用結構體(struct)組合在一起。

4、只有32個保留字(reserved keywords),使變數、函式命名有更多彈性。

5、部份的變數型別可以轉換,例如整型和字元型變數。

6、通過指標(pointer),c語言可以容易的對儲存器進行低階控制。

7、預編譯處理(preprocessor)讓c語言的編譯更具有彈性。

8樓:

簡單的說 c 中的結構體 成了 c++裡的類

結構體就是 可以把所有c庫 變數 和函式 都能包含的一個集體

比如 你用qq 傳送一條訊息給對方

簡單的資料結構可以是一個結構體

struct message *p_message;

呼叫的話 就用p_message 這個指標

c++class cmessage

;class cmessage h_pmessage;

呼叫 的話 用控制代碼 h_pmessage;

-------------

物件導向的話

c++ 就要牽扯到繼承 這個是c++ 有的特點

c中 只能通過包含這個結構體的宣告的標頭檔案 來使用

此外還有,c語言與c++的區別有很多:

1,全新的程式程式思維,c語言是程序導向的,而c++是物件導向的。

2,c語言有標準的函式庫,它們鬆散的,只是把功能相同的函式放在一個標頭檔案中;而c++對於大多數的 函式都是有整合的很緊密,特別是c語言中沒有的c++中的api是對window系統的大多數api有機的組合 ,是一個集體。但你也可能單獨呼叫api。

3,特別是c++中的圖形處理,它和語言的圖形有很大的區別。c語言中的圖形處理函式基本上是不能用在 中c++中的。c語言標準中不包括圖形處理。

4,c和c++中都有結構的概念,但是在c語言中結構只有成員變數,而沒成員方法,而在c++中結構中,它 可以有自己的成員變數和成員函式。但是在c語言中結構的成員是公共的,什麼想訪問它的都可以訪問 ;而在vc++中它沒有加限定符的為私有的。

5,c語言可以寫很多方面的程式,但是c++可以寫得更多更好,c++可以寫基於dosr程式,寫dll,寫控制元件 ,寫系統。

6,c語言對程式的檔案的組織是鬆散的,幾乎是全要程式處理;而c++對檔案的組織是以工程,各檔案分 類明確。

7,c++中的ide很智慧,和vb一樣,有的功能可能比vb還強。

8,c++對可以自動生成你想要的程式結構使你可以省了很多時間。有很多可用的工具如加入mfc中的類的 時候,加入變數的時候等等。

9,c++中的附加工具也有很多,可以進行系統的分析,可以檢視api;可以檢視控制元件。

10,除錯功能強大,並且方法多樣。

每年舉行2次c語言二級考試,4月的第一個星期六和9月的第3個星期六

有機試和筆試,各100分

9樓:匿名使用者

首先宣告,我也剛開始學習c。建議你先看c,再看c++。因為c++是在c的基礎上發展起來的,c++在許多方面都加強了c的功能(比如新增了引用這種新的變數型別,還增加了內建函式,並加強了物件導向的功能,具體參考東北大學出版社的《新概念c語言》)。

而且,c++中常使用輸入輸出流cin、cout,而不常用printf和scanf。這與二級你考試中用printf和scanf有一定區別,你要考試就要根據考試的規則來。所以,還是認真看譚的書吧,看完了你想更深入的學習的話再讀c++,你才能領會到c++究竟在哪些方面增強了c的功能。

你可以買套二級模擬試卷(帶光碟的那種)來做。二級考試中的有些東西《c程式設計》這本書上的確沒有,比如棧。但只要你把那本書讀好,過二級應該沒問題。

程式設計題都是《c程式設計》上的。

你也可以多問問老師同學的意見,我的話不一定可信。自己把握自己!努力!!!

10樓:扈懷煒

這兩種語言基本沒什麼區別,語法是一樣的,只是在c語言中不支援類和物件,c++支援類和物件,另外就是一些函式變得簡單了,c++畢竟是物件導向的,如果要考試拿證的話,可能c簡單一些,如果是為了學知識,c++更適合一些。

11樓:匿名使用者

考的內容不一樣,認真回答希望可以幫到你。

12樓:綠荷之心

二級c考的是turboc的內容,但是考試環境是vc++6.0。所有考試重點都是c的內容。

二級c++是另外一科,考的類和派生更多一些,但是考試內容和c是不一樣的。

書店應該有全國統一的教材《全國計算機等級二級c語言教程》

13樓:匿名使用者

c++裡面沒有指標,c語言裡有指標;c語言裡的指標非常重要,對於初學者來說難。但必須要會使用c語言編輯器tc和vc++.希望你在書店裡找到有關c語言的書

只要把c語言弄懂了,c++學起來就不那麼吃力。

計算機二級考試c語言和vb該選哪個 5

14樓:匿名使用者

我也學c語言,我也報考計二的c語言專案,但是告訴你一個可怕的訊息,計二c語言不會考書上的題目,聽說考未來教育上面的題目。

計算機二級C語言試題,計算機二級考試C語言分值構成是怎樣的?

輸出結果是 136,這三個數字,不是一百三十六,這段 一共呼叫了3次這個函式fun int x 第一次是6,執行完if後,在執行fun 3 函式,這時不會進行列印語句,第二次是3,執行完if後,再執行fun 1 函式,第三次是if 1 2 0 這時不滿足if的條件,轉而執行列印語句,由於一共執行了三...

計算機二級考試C語言

其實也不必做什麼題目,看一下公共基礎,把課本好看看一下,課本上的那些演算法好好看一下,就可以了,有部分題是關於資料結構和軟體測試方面的。大多數還是c語言,一般考的不難,但是題很刁鑽古怪。一不小心就出錯,還是要很小心才好。多看看往年的2級考試題吧 對你幫助很大的 作晚年的題,作完多看幾次就好,很容易過...

計算機二級C 考什麼,計算機二級考試C語言與C 有什麼區別

河傳楊穎 二級c 考試內容 c 語言概述 c 語言資料型別 運算子和表示式 基本控制語句 陣列 指標與引用 函式 類和物件繼承 模板等內容。計算機二級c 考生不受年齡 職業 學歷等背景的限制,任何人均可根據自己學習和使用計算機的實際情況報考。每次考試報名的具體時間由各省 自治區 直轄市 級承辦機構規...